1. Saint Hubert Parish Marker
Inscription.
Established 1907
by
Archbishop Blenk - New Orleans
Fr. Tessier, first Pastor
Former church destroyed 1965
Hurricane Betsy
New church built 1967-Fr. Arjonilla
Hall built 1976-rectory 1980-Fr. Caluda
